What is an Infrared Blaster?
An infrared blaster, often referred to as an IR blaster, is a device designed to transmit infrared signals that control other electronic devices. By emitting invisible infrared light, these blasters can communicate with various gadgets, primarily those designed to respond to remote control signals, like televisions, DVD players, air conditioners, and more.
In essence, the infrared blaster functions similarly to a traditional remote control but usually offers enhanced features such as smartphone compatibility or the integration of multiple devices into a single control interface.
How Does an Infrared Blaster Work?
The operation of an infrared blaster hinges on the principles of infrared radiation and signal transmission. Let’s explore this process step-by-step.
Infrared Light and Signal Transmission
- Infrared Light: First, it is essential to understand that infrared light is a type of electromagnetic radiation, falling just below visible light on the spectrum. Humans cannot see infrared light, but many devices can detect and respond to it.
- Signal Generation: When a user presses a button on the remote or via a smartphone app equipped with an IR blaster, the device generates a specific infrared signal. This signal corresponds to a command, like turning up the volume or changing the channel on a TV.
- Transmission: The infrared blaster then transmits this signal through the air, allowing it to reach any compatible device within its range (usually around 5 to 30 feet, depending on various factors like obstructions).
- Receiving Device: The receiving device, which is equipped with its infrared receiver, picks up the transmitted signal and decodes it. Depending on the command, the device executes the desired action.
Differences between Infrared and Other Technologies
It’s important to note the difference between infrared and other wireless technologies. While modern devices often boast Bluetooth and Wi-Fi capabilities for communication, infrared remains distinct in several ways:
- Line-of-Sight Requirement: Infrared signals require a clear line of sight to work effectively, meaning obstacles can disrupt the transmission.
- Limited Range: Unlike Bluetooth or Wi-Fi, which can operate over significant distances, infrared typically has a much shorter range.
- Lower Power Consumption: Infrared devices are generally more power-efficient since they only activate when transmitting specific commands.

How does an infrared blaster work?
Infrared blasters function using a simple broadcasting principle. They emit infrared light pulses that carry encoded data, allowing remote devices to pick up these signals. Each device has a specific code that the IR blaster uses to communicate with it. When the blaster’s button is pressed, it transmits the correct sequence of pulses, which the receiving device interprets as a command, such as changing the volume or channel.
For effective communication, infrared signals require a direct line of sight between the blaster and the receiving device. If obstacles block this path, or if the devices are too far apart, the command may not register. This is why infrared technology is often used in scenarios where devices are arranged closely together, such as in a home theater setup or around a living room.

Are there any limitations to infrared blasters?
Yes, infrared blasters do come with certain limitations that users should be aware of. One significant limitation is that IR signals require a clear line of sight to function effectively. Any obstruction between the blaster and the device being controlled can prevent the signal from reaching its target, which can be a significant inconvenience in larger rooms or when devices are obscured by furniture.
Additionally, infrared technology has a limited range, typically around 30 feet, depending on the strength of the blaster and the sensitivity of the receiving device. If your entertainment system spans a larger area, you might find that an IR blaster isn’t sufficient. There may also be latency issues where the response time of commands is not instantaneous, leading to delays between button presses and action on the device.
